Debian

Debian İşletim Sisteminde Dosya ve Klasör İzinleri Nasıl Ayarlanır?

Debian İşletim Sisteminde Dosya ve Klasör İzinleri Nasıl Ayarlanır?
Share

Debian İşletim Sistemi kullanıcılarının sıklıkla karşılaştığı sorunlardan biri, dosya ve klasör izinleri konusudur. Dosya ve klasör izinleri, kullanıcılara, gruplara ve diğer kullanıcılara belirli erişim seviyeleri sağlar. Bu nedenle, bu konuyu anlamak ve doğru şekilde ayarlamak oldukça önemlidir. Bu blog yazısında, Debian İşletim Sistemi üzerinde dosya ve klasör izinlerinin nasıl kontrol edileceği ve ayarlanacağı hakkında temel bilgileri bulabilirsiniz. Ayrıca, kullanıcı izinleri, grup izinleri ve diğer kullanıcıların izinlerinin nasıl ayarlanacağını da öğreneceksiniz.

Debian İşletim Sisteminde Dosya ve Klasör İzinleri

Bir işletim sisteminde dosya ve klasör izinleri, her bir dosya ve klasörün kimin tarafından erişilebileceğini ve hangi işlemlerin gerçekleştirilebileceğini belirler. Debian işletim sistemi, güvenlik ve gizlilik açısından önemli birçok özelliği içermektedir ve dosya ve klasör izinleri de bunlardan biridir.

Dosya ve klasör izinlerinin temel amacı, kullanıcılara ve kullanıcı gruplarına, dosyaları ve klasörleri okuma, yazma veya çalıştırma gibi belirli işlemler yapma yetkisi veren bir kontrol mekanizması sunmaktır. Özellikle çok kullanıcılı sistemlerde, izinlerin doğru bir şekilde ayarlanması, bilgilerin güvenliğini sağlamak için önemli bir adımdır.

Debian işletim sisteminde dosya ve klasör izinleri kontrol edilirken, chmod komutu kullanılır. Bu komut sayesinde dosya ve klasörlerin izinleri kullanıcı, grup ve diğer kullanıcılar için ayrı ayrı belirlenebilir. İzinler, sayılarla ifade edilir ve her bir izin, belirli bir sayısal değeri temsil eder. Örneğin, “rwx” (okuma, yazma ve çalıştırma) izni, “7” olarak ifade edilir.

  • Debian işletim sisteminde dosya ve klasör izinleri, bilgisayar güvenliği ve gizliliği açısından oldukça önemlidir.
  • İzinlerin doğru bir şekilde ayarlanması, yetkisiz erişimlerin önlenmesi ve bilgilerin güvenliğinin sağlanması için gereklidir.
  • chmod komutu, dosya ve klasör izinlerini kontrol etmek ve ayarlamak için kullanılır.
İzin Numeric Değer Açıklama
r 4 Okuma izni
w 2 Yazma izni
x 1 Çalıştırma izni

Dosyaların ve klasörlerin izinleri, kullanıcı, grup ve diğer kullanıcılar için ayrı ayrı belirlenebilir. Bu sayede, her kullanıcının farklı izinlere sahip olmasını sağlamak ve kullanıcıların yetkisiz erişimlere karşı korunmasını sağlamak mümkündür.

Debian işletim sistemi, güvenlik konusunda sağladığı özelliklerle kullanıcılarının bilgilerini koruma altına alırken, dosya ve klasör izinleri de bu güvenlik önlemlerinden biridir. Dosya ve klasör izinleri sayesinde, kullanıcıların yetkisiz erişimlere karşı güvende olması ve bilgilerinin gizliliği sağlanabilir.

Dosya ve Klasör İzinleri Hakkında Temel Bilgiler

Dosya ve klasör izinleri, işletim sistemleri tarafından sağlanan bir güvenlik mekanizmasıdır. Bu izinler, kullanıcıların dosya ve klasörler üzerinde hangi işlemleri yapabileceğini belirler. İzinler, kullanıcılara veya kullanıcı gruplarına atanır ve her bir izne farklı bir hüküm verir. Bu nedenle, dosya ve klasör izinlerini anlamak ve doğru şekilde ayarlamak oldukça önemlidir.

İzinler genellikle üç temel kategoride sınıflandırılır: okuma, yazma ve çalıştırma. Okuma izni, bir dosyanın veya klasörün içeriğini görüntülemeyi sağlar. Yazma izni, bir dosyayı veya klasörü değiştirmek, silmek veya oluşturmak için gereklidir. Çalıştırma izni ise bir dosyanın veya klasörün çalıştırılabilir olduğunu belirtir.

Dosya ve klasör izinleri, dosya sistemi üzerindeki güvenliği sağlamak için kullanılır. Yanlış izinler, kötü niyetli kullanıcıların veya zararlı yazılımların sisteme erişimini kolaylaştırabilir. Bu nedenle, izinlerin doğru şekilde ayarlanması büyük önem taşır.

  • Okuma izni: Dosya veya klasör içeriğini görüntülemek için gereklidir.
  • Yazma izni: Dosya veya klasör üzerinde değişiklik yapmak, silmek veya oluşturmak için gereklidir.
  • Çalıştırma izni: Dosya veya klasörün çalıştırılabilir olduğunu belirtir.
Kod Açıklama
r Okuma izni
w Yazma izni
x Çalıştırma izni

Dosya ve Klasör İzinleri Neden Önemlidir?

Dosya ve klasör izinleri, işletim sistemlerindeki bir dosyanın veya klasörün erişebilirlik düzeyini belirlemek için kullanılan önemli bir kavramdır. Bu izinler, dosyanın veya klasörün sahibi, grup üyeleri ve diğer kullanıcılar arasında erişim yetkilerini kontrol eder. Dosya ve klasör izinlerinin doğru bir şekilde ayarlanması, güvenlik, gizlilik ve veri bütünlüğü açısından büyük bir öneme sahiptir.

Bir dosyanın veya klasörün izinleri, onu oluşturan kullanıcının yetkilerini belirler. Dosya sahibi, üzerinde tam kontrol sahibi olurken, grup üyeleri ve diğer kullanıcılar sınırlı yetkilere sahip olabilir. Örneğin, bir dosyanın sadece okunabilir veya yazılabilir olması gibi. Bu izinler, yetkisi olmayan kişilerin dosyalara ve klasörlere erişmesini engelleyerek, önemli verilerin güvenliğini sağlar.

Ayrıca, dosya ve klasör izinleri, bir ağ ortamında da büyük bir rol oynar. Özellikle birden fazla kullanıcının bulunduğu sistemlerde, her kullanıcının farklı izinlere sahip olması önemlidir. Bu sayede, bir kullanıcının yanlışlıkla veya kötü niyetle diğer kullanıcıların dosyalarına zarar verme riski en aza indirilir. Aynı şekilde, sadece belirli kişilerin belirli dosyalara erişebilmesi için izinlerin doğru bir şekilde ayarlanması gerekmektedir.

Genel olarak, dosya ve klasör izinleri veri güvenliği açısından büyük bir öneme sahiptir. Doğru izinlerin ayarlanması, hassas verilerin yetkisiz kişilerin eline geçmesini engeller ve veri bütünlüğünü korur. Bu nedenle, dosya ve klasör izinlerinin doğru bir şekilde kontrol edilmesi ve ayarlanması, işletim sisteminin güvenliğini sağlamak için son derece önemlidir.

Dosya ve Klasör İzinleri Nasıl Kontrol Edilir?

Dosya ve klasör izinleri, bir işletim sisteminin güvenlik mekanizmalarının temel parçalarından biridir. Bu izinler, kullanıcıların, grupların veya diğer yetkili kişilerin bir dosya veya klasöre erişim, okuma, yazma veya değiştirme gibi eylemleri gerçekleştirmelerini kontrol eder. Bu izinlerin düzgün bir şekilde kontrol edilmesi, bilgisayar sistemlerinin güvenliğini sağlamak için önemlidir.

Dosya ve klasör izinleri, Linux tabanlı işletim sistemleri için özellikle önemlidir. Debian işletim sistemi de bu kategoriye dahildir. Bu işletim sisteminde dosya ve klasör izinlerini kontrol etmek ve düzenlemek oldukça kolaydır.

Dosya ve klasör izinlerini kontrol etmek için chmod komutunu kullanabiliriz. Bu komutla, tüm izinlere, kullanıcı, grup veya diğer kullanıcılar için ayrı ayrı izinleri belirleyebilir ve yönetebiliriz. Ayrıca chown ve chgrp gibi komutlarla dosyaların veya klasörlerin sahiplerini ve gruplarını değiştirebiliriz.

  • chmod: Dosya ve klasör izinlerini değiştirmek için kullanılan komut.
  • chown: Dosyanın veya klasörün sahibini değiştirmek için kullanılan komut.
  • chgrp: Dosyanın veya klasörün grubunu değiştirmek için kullanılan komut.
İzinler Yetki
r Okuma yetkisi
w Yazma yetkisi
x Çalıştırma yetkisi

Dosya ve klasör izinlerini kontrol etmek için öncelikle izinleri görüntülemek gerekmektedir. Bunun için ls -l komutunu kullanabiliriz. Bu komutla dosya veya klasörün izinleri, sahibi, grup bilgileri ve diğer bazı ayrıntılar listelenir.

Dosya ve klasör izinlerini değiştirmek için ise chmod komutunu kullanırız. Örneğin, bir dosyaya yazma yetkisi vermek için aşağıdaki komutu kullanabiliriz:

chmod +w dosya.txt

Aynı şekilde, bir klasöre çalıştırma yetkisi vermek için chmod +x klasör komutunu kullanabiliriz.

Dosya ve klasör izinlerini kontrol etmek ve düzenlemek, Linux tabanlı işletim sistemlerinde güvenlik ve veri bütünlüğünü sağlamak için önemlidir. Dolayısıyla, bu izinlerin nasıl kontrol edileceği ve düzenleneceği konusunda bilgi sahibi olmak, bir sistemi güvende tutmanın temel adımlarından biridir.

Kullanıcı İzinleri Nasıl Ayarlanır?

Kullanıcı izinleri, bir işletim sistemi üzerindeki dosya ve klasörlerin erişimini ve kullanımını düzenlemek için kullanılır. Bu izinler, kullanıcıların dosyaları okumasına, yazmasına veya değiştirmesine izin verirken, diğer kullanıcılardan bu dosyaları korur. Bu nedenle, kullanıcı izinleri, güvenlik ve gizlilik açısından son derece önemlidir.

Debian işletim sistemi de kullanıcı izinleri üzerinde detaylı bir kontrol sağlar. Kullanıcı izinleri, üç farklı kategoriye ayrılmıştır: sahip, grup ve diğer kullanıcılar. Her bir kategori için izin düzeyleri farklıdır ve bu izinler, chmod komutu kullanılarak ayarlanabilir. Örneğin, bir dosyanın sadece okunabilir olmasını istiyorsak, chmod 444 dosya_adı komutunu kullanabiliriz.

Diğer bir önemli not, kullanıcı izinlerinin doğru şekilde ayarlanması için kullanıcıların işlem yapabilme yetkisi olması gerektiğidir. Root kullanıcısı, kullanıcı izinlerini değiştirme yetkisi olan tek kullanıcıdır. Diğer kullanıcılar, kendi dosyaları üzerindeki izinleri değiştirebilirler ancak diğer kullanıcıların dosyalarına müdahale edemezler.

Komut Açıklama
chmod Belirli dosya veya klasörlerin izinlerini değiştirmek için kullanılır
chown Bir dosya veya klasörün sahibini değiştirmek için kullanılır
chgrp Bir dosya veya klasörün grubunu değiştirmek için kullanılır

Dosya ve klasör izinleri üzerinde doğru bir kontrol yapmak, dosyalarınızın güvenliği için önemlidir. Kullanıcı izinlerini doğru şekilde ayarlamak, yetkisiz erişimlerden kaçınarak verilerinizi korumanıza yardımcı olur. Bu nedenle, kullanıcı izinlerini nasıl ayarlayacağınızı öğrenmek ve bunları düzenli olarak kontrol etmek önemlidir.

Grup İzinleri Nasıl Ayarlanır?

Linux işletim sistemleri, kullanıcıları ve grupları kontrol etmek için üstün bir esneklik sunar. Dosya ve klasör izinleri, kullanıcıların ve grupların dosyalara ve klasörlere erişim düzeylerini belirler. Grup izinleri, dosya ve klasörlerin belirli bir gruba veya kullanıcı grubuna ait olmasını sağlar ve erişim yetkilerini bu gruba tanır.

Kullanıcılar ve gruplar arasında izin ayarlamaları yapmak için “chown” ve “chgrp” komutları kullanılır. “chown” komutu, dosyanın veya klasörün sahibini değiştirmek için kullanılırken, “chgrp” komutu dosyanın veya klasörün grubunu değiştirmek için kullanılır.

Dosyanın veya klasörün grubu değiştirildikten sonra, grup izinlerini ayarlamak için “chmod” komutunu kullanabilirsiniz. “chmod” komutu, dosyanın veya klasörün erişim yetkilerini belirlemek için kullanılır ve bu yetkileri okuma, yazma ve yürütme gibi üç ayrı kategori altında gruplara tanır.

  • Okuma Yetkisi (Read): Grup üyeleri, dosyayı veya klasörü sadece okuyabilirler.
  • Yazma Yetkisi (Write): Grup üyeleri, dosyayı veya klasörü okuyabilir ve üzerinde değişiklik yapabilirler.
  • Yürütme Yetkisi (Execute): Grup üyeleri, dosyayı veya klasörü çalıştırabilirler.

Grup izinlerini ayarlamak için kullanılan sembolik ve octal modlar vardır. Sembolik mod, dosya ve klasör izinlerini sembollerle temsil ederken, octal mod ise izinleri rakamlarla temsil eder.

Yetki Sembolik Mod Octal Mod
Okuma r 4
Yazma w 2
Yürütme x 1

Aşağıdaki örnek, “grup_izinleri” adlı bir dosyanın grubunun “kullanici_grup” olarak değiştirilmesini ve grup üyelerine okuma ve yazma yetkisi verilmesini gösterir:

chgrp kullanici_grup grup_izinleri
chmod g+rw grup_izinleri

Diğer Kullanıcıların İzinleri Nasıl Ayarlanır?

Diğer kullanıcıların izinleri nasıl ayarlanır? Bu sorunun cevabı, birçok kullanıcının ve sistem yöneticisinin merak ettiği bir konudur. Dosya ve klasör izinleri, bir işletim sisteminin güvenliği ve veri bütünlüğünü sağlamak için çok önemlidir. Özellikle birden fazla kullanıcının bulunduğu bir ortamda, izinlerin doğru bir şekilde ayarlanması gerekmektedir.

Diğer kullanıcıların izinlerini ayarlamak için, öncelikle dosya veya klasörün sahibi olmanız gerekmektedir. Ardından, chmod komutunu kullanarak izinleri değiştirebilirsiniz. Bu komutun kullanımı oldukça basittir. Örneğin, bir dosyaya veya klasöre yazma izni vermek için aşağıdaki komutu kullanabilirsiniz:

chmod +w dosya_adı

  1. +w: Yazma izni vermek için kullanılır.
  2. +r: Okuma izni vermek için kullanılır.
  3. +x: Çalıştırma izni vermek için kullanılır.
Kullanıcılar İzinler
owner rwx
group r-x
others r-x

Yukarıda verilen tabloda, kullanıcıların sahip olabileceği izinlerin bir örneği bulunmaktadır. Owner (sahibi), grup ve diğer kullanıcılar izinlere farklı düzeyde erişim sağlayabilirler. İzinlerin doğru bir şekilde ayarlanabilmesi için, bu farklılıkları iyi anlamak gerekmektedir.